Determining @trusted-status

It seems that @safe will be de jure, whether by the current state
of DIP1028 or otherwise. However, I'm unsure how to responsibly
determine whether a FFI may be @trusted: the type signature and
the body. Should I run, for example, a C library through valgrind
to observe any memory leaks/corruption? Is it enough to trust the
authors of a library (e.g. SDL and OpenAL) where applying
@trusted is acceptable?
There's probably no one right answer, but I'd be very thankful
for some clarity, regardless.
